BuzzFeed's Founder/CEO Jonah Peretti on the Media's Evolution

This week, social news organization BuzzFeed's CEO and founder Jonah Peretti came to town as part of Chicago Ideas Week to participate in a talk at the Goodman Theater.

The subject was "Future of News: What's the Story?" and he was there discussing that with Jumo's Chris Hughes, Pulse's Akshay Kotahri and Syria Deeply's Lara Setrakian. 

Before that talk, though, I sat down with Peretti backstage at the Goodman to discuss what he feels are the greatest challenges facing his company and other burgeoning media outlets getting their starts nowadays.
